SUMMARY OF POSITION:

Medical Laboratory Science Program director is responsible for organization, administration, instruction, evaluation, continuous quality improvement, curriculum planning and development, directing other program faculty/staff, and general effectiveness of the MLS program.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ATION(S):

  • Master's Degree required
  • Holds ASCP-BOC or ASCPi-BOC generalist certification as Medical Laboratory Scientist/Medical Technologist
  • Three (3) years' experience in a CLIA certified clinical/medical diagnostic laboratory
  • Three (3) years' teaching experience (bench teaching or program level teaching)

PREFERRED QUALIFICATION(S):

  • Has knowledge of education methods and NAACLS accreditation procedures and certification procedures]
  • Has participated in NAACLS accreditation process (as educator in NAACLS-accredited program, site visitor, self-study paper reviewer, etc.)

About Penn State Health

Penn State Health is a multi-hospital health system serving patients and communities across central Pennsylvania. It is part of Penn State University and includes Penn State Health Milton S. Hershey Medical Center, Penn State Children's Hospital, and Penn State Cancer Institute. The health system provides a full range of medical services, including primary care, specialty care, and emergency care. Penn State Health is committed to advancing medical research and education, and is home to the Penn State College of Medicine.
